Abstract
The statistics of liquid-to-crystal nucleation are measured for clathrate-forming mixtures of tetrahydrofuran (THF) and water using an automatic lag time apparatus (ALTA). We measure the nucleation temperature using this new apparatus in which a single sample is repeatedly cooled, nucleated and thawed. This is done for a series of tetrahydrofuran concentrations and in several different sample tubes since the nucleation is heterogeneous and so occurring on the tube wall. The measurements are also done at the same concentrations and tubes but with an added catalyst, a single crystal of silver iodide.
